> I finally had the time to make a test case, and indeed, there's a bug in
> the source mapper. Please download this archive
> <https://www.dropbox.com/s/uologjerfce1q8e/source-map-test.tar.bz2?dl=0>
> and run "make" on Linux / OS X. This example will build a library and a
> program, all with -g4.
>
> Here's the output if you don't want to bother compiling:
>
> ▶ make
> make -C libfoo
> em++ -g4 -o foo.o -c src/foo.cpp
> emar rcs libfoo.a foo.o
> make -C bar
> em++ -g4 -o bar.o -c src/bar.cpp -I../libfoo/src
> emcc -g4 -o bar.bc bar.o -L../libfoo -lfoo
> emcc -g4 -o bar.html bar.bc
> sourcemapper: Unable to find original file for src/foo.cpp at
> /Users/Warren/Downloads/source-map-test/bar/src/foo.cpp
>
> I have noticed that if I move the source files in their parent directory,
> the source mapper doesn't produce this error. I suspect the source mapper
> is confused by the fact that both the library and the program source files
> are located in a "src" directory.

>> I can generate source maps for my main program, but when linking
>> libraries generated from different paths, the source mapper can't find the
>> source files for libraries. The source mapper doesn't allow to specify
>> multiple look-up paths and even if it did, I'm sure it'd introduce new
>> issues.
>>
>> Here are the questions:
>>
>>    - What's the current status for the Emscripten source mapper? Are
>>    people really able to use it to debug large codebases including libraries?
>>    - Would it be possible to build each source map when building
>>    libraries, and somehow merge them when linking?
>>    - If not, what's the workaround? Using absolute paths when building?
